His ability to negate powers isn't absolute, true, however it's still a huge added bonus, for instance it grants him immunity to some pretty insane abilities (such as time manipulation or force persuade), and even when he can't stop the powers (which appears to be the case with radiation and flight) it's likely he can lessen the effect. But what I really find powerful about him isn't the power negate but the potency of his memory destruction ability. In It takes a Village he was able to mind wipe his entire freaking village, to the point where they couldn't even talk, and just became mindless zombies, and he did it in a heartbeat. The fact that it's a mental attack means that not many would have any sort of defence, and the sheer scale of the ability is immense.
